How do i create an opt-out option for an email newsletter?

0

Decide how your email subscribers will unsubscribe from your newsletters. Check with your email service provider, if you use a commercial service provider, for any proprietary code that it provides to help subscribers opt out of mailings. Alternately, create a web page on your server where any user can enter his email address, indicate his subscription preferences and submit his information to your database. Do not request more than the subscriber’s email address to unsubscribe. You could also designate an email address to which subscribers can mail a request to opt out of your newsletter.Add to your email newsletter template a link to your email service provider’s “Subscription” page, a web page you created on your server or your dedicated email account. Most email marketers put this link in the footer of their emails, along with the company name, mailing address and privacy policy.
